OceanGrown International, the beauty and health company that uses natural resources from the earth and its oceans in their products, is launching a brand new blog to share stories and results from their newest weight management product, OceanBreakers BURN.

The company hopes that the blog will give BURN customers, new and old alike, a place to share thoughts, ideas and goals for weight loss and weight management. OGI hopes that especially during this time of the year, as the New Year approaches, customers will come together to renew their commitment to a weight loss.

The new blog, titled “Losing Weight Never Tasted so Good” is actually pretty good. The blog has lots of great features including customer testimonials of their experience with the BURN product, and provides a place to share stories of success.

The new OceanBreakers products contain Fucoxanthin which is a brown kelp extract that is currently being studies for its possible ability to increase basal metabolic rate which increases the body’s ability to burn fat and calories. The fucoxanthin is combined with Coral Calcium, Hoodia, B Vitams and Yerba mate to create an all natural, unique form of weight loss control.

“This blog provides a way for all OGI customers to share their story with OceanBreakers - BURN,” said Kerry Brown, OGI president. “Many people have found astonishing success with our delicious weight management product and I’m thrilled we now have an online home to feature each and every customer experience.”

Nature’s Bounty, a subsidiary of NBTY - a global direct sales health and wellness company, is joining forces with several organizations to make their company and the earth, a little bit greener.

Natures Bounty, has just launched the Healthy You, Healthy Earth Campaign, which is a company wide plan to reduce their carbon footprint and become a more responsible, eco-friendly, and greener company.

For years Natures Bounty has tried to be aware of global environmental issues and has taken steps to make a difference including recycling projects- using recycled goods as well as recycling their own products. Now they have taken it up a notch by redesigning their packaging, switching to CFC lighting and using water based ink for all of their copying. Then company hopes that they can reduce their carbon footprint by 5 million pounds of CO2 per year.

Natures Bounty is also joining forces with several eco friendly organizations such as Trees for the Future, an environment group that plants new trees around the world, and The Go Green Initiative, an organization that educations children about the environment and way that they can help and protect the earth.

Natures Bounty is among several Network Marketing companies who are really focusing on Green initiatives. Shaklee, Mannatech, Ocean Grown and others have initiatives underway to reduce their carbon footprint and be more eco-friendly.

Ocean Grown International - the health care company whose products are all natural and derived from the earth and ocean - is taking action to ensure that the planet and its oceans are protected. OGI products come from natural ingredients found in oceans throughout the world. OGI realizes the importance of the oceans and how valuable the plant and animal life in it are to our ecosystem..

Ocean Grown is petitioning the United Nations to declare June 8th as World Ocean Day. OGI hopes to recognize that day to celebrate the world’s oceans and what they provide to the people of the earth. OGI aims to raise awareness and provide education and action programs to promote respect of the ocean. The company also hopes that by dedicating one day a year to awareness of the ocean, the governments of the world will recognize that more must be done to protect them.

Ocean Grown is hoping to draw attention to the growing need of ocean preservation. Its important not just to protect the planet, but the oceans and water that comprise almost 75% of the planet.
